    I looked at those Axminster xy tables a long time ago when planning my drill press upgrade. In the spec they said it was not a precision table and was only for general xy movement. I also tried one out in the shop and also wasn’t sure about it.

    I also looked at a few of those more expensive red and green ones but wasn’t convinced about the quality from the few videos I looked at. Also travel was quite limited especially Y. So I will be making my own but it depends what you are going for.

    Also looked at spare xy tables for ArcEuro milling machines but they had limited travel and the price was going up.

    I would be interested to know if the ways are tight and straight on yours and if you have swept them with a DTI to say how good they are and if they are close to 90 degrees.
